
The fact that businesses want to do jobs based on their abilities and skills has revealed a common practice of "outsourcing" or "outsourcing". Outsourcing both saves resources, downsizes and becomes lean, and they find the opportunity to focus on the jobs they know very well.
Importance of Outsourcing
There are multiple reasons why outsourcing is becoming increasingly important. The competition between businesses has reached a level that does not cause any mistakes. However, reducing costs by agreeing with producers working with lower costs is another important factor. As a result of the rapid advancement of information and communication technology, great advantages are achieved by using outsourcing in cosmopolitan areas and routine works.
Thanks to the flexibility that outsourcing gives us, the factors that cause problems are reduced or eliminated by being completely rejected. Especially in America, 65% of companies are outsourced by their human resources department. Outsourcing has many advantages for human resources. The most important of these is that it reduces the workload. For example, when training programs for company employees are to be carried out, tasks such as researching training companies are the responsibility of the human resources department. However, if the work is outsourced to a consulting company, possible mistakes will be prevented and time will be saved.

If we consider the use of Outsourcing with its main lines, we can list the benefits it provides to us as follows:
- Focus on the core business,
- Collecting scattered data in a single center,
- The opportunity to reach the desired information in a short time,
- Protection of privacy,
- Saving time,
- Increase in efficiency,
- Using technology from outside,
- Work done by an expert,
- Ensuring more effective use of resources,
- Access to the best practices in the world,
- Savings in costs.
These factors have an important place in today's competitive environment. For this reason, outsourcing areas are increasing day by day.
Application of Outsourcing
If the manager decides to use outsourcing, he should seek answers to 3 key questions:
1. What is the potential competitive advantage that can be achieved in this activity by considering commercial values?
2. What is our potential vulnerability rate when there is a market failure?
3. How should we arrange control with suppliers to see the least damage? (considering elasticity of demand)
